Lakmangule Population - Koppal, Karnataka

Lakmangule is a medium size village located in Yelbarga Taluka of Koppal district, Karnataka with total 173 families residing. The Lakmangule village has population of 909 of which 472 are males while 437 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Lakmangule village population of children with age 0-6 is 142 which makes up 15.62 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Lakmangule village is 926 which is lower than Karnataka state average of 973. Child Sex Ratio for the Lakmangule as per census is 893, lower than Karnataka average of 948.

Lakmangule village has lower literacy rate compared to Karnataka. In 2011, literacy rate of Lakmangule village was 42.24 % compared to 75.36 % of Karnataka. In Lakmangule Male literacy stands at 49.62 % while female literacy rate was 34.32 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Tribe (ST) constitutes 19.69 % while Schedule Caste (SC) were 13.97 % of total population in Lakmangule village.

Work Profile

In Lakmangule village out of total population, 576 were engaged in work activities. 99.83 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 0.17 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 576 workers engaged in Main Work, 560 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 0 were Agricultural labourer.
